Please Note: As of July 21, 2021, users of the Celtx Legacy desktop software will no longer be able to directly access projects stored in their celtx.com account.
Users can still log into their celtx.com accounts via browser to download their legacy projects (.celtx files), until June 21st, 2021. Those files can then be edited locally on their computer, or, uploaded to celtx.com as new project scripts.

In 2013, development, support, and distribution of the Celtx desktop software (version 2.9.7 and older) was discontinued. However, .celtx files are compatible with the Celtx Online Studio, and can be uploaded to your online account.
In 2019, Apple's OSX "Catalina" update dropped all support for 32-bit applications, including Celtx 2.9.7. Given development has ended on this product Celtx 2.9.7, is completely incompatible with Catalina, nor is it recommended for use on 32-bit operating systems.
